This Riverdale review contains spoilers.
Riverdale Season 6 Episode 4
“Happy sad endings are the best.”
While the eagerly awaited appearance of now twentysomething witch Sabrina got all the pre-air hype, the fourth installment of Riverdale‘s “Rivervale” experiment is really Madelaine Petsch’s tour de force. Portraying not only Cheryl, but her ancestors Poppy and Abigail, Petsch delivers a nuanced performance — well, three of them — that shed new light on the tragedy suffered by the Blossom women across the generations.
As such, what was billed as a Chilling Adventures of Sabrina crossover was instead a Gothic rumination on forbidden love and persecution that easily stands as arguably the show’s most mature hour.. Much ado on the series has been made about the curse that Abigail inflicted upon the town, yet here we see the damnation that the Blossom’s have been forced to endure in the “house of secrets and mysteries” that is Thornhill.

HBO has put in development The Dolls, a limited series with Laura Dern and Issa Rae attached attached to star and executive produce. The project hails from Dern and Jayme Lemons’ Jaywalker Pictures. Rae, who’s under a deal with HBO, also will co-write the project with Laura Kittrell and Amy Aniobi, who work with Rae on HBO’s Insecure, which has been renewed for a fourth season.
Written by Rae, Kittrell and Aniobi, The Dolls, inspired by true events, recounts the aftermath of Christmas Eve riots within two small Arkansas towns in 1983…riots which erupted over, yes,…Cabbage Patch Dolls. The limited series explores class, race, privilege and what it takes to be a “good mother.”
Rae, Dern, Lemons and Deniese Davis (Insecure) executive produce. Kittrell and Aniobi co-executive produce.

Society outcast adaptation Mr & Mrs American Pie in development.
New Los Angeles-based television production and distribution operation Platform One Media has signed a first-look TV deal with Laura Dern and Jayme Lemons’ production company Jaywalker Pictures.
Already in development under the deal is Mr & Mrs American Pie, a potential one-hour series based on a novel by Juliet McDaniel that Platform One has optioned from publisher Inkshares. Set in 1969, the novel is about a Palm Springs socialite’s attempt to rebuild her identity after her husband leaves her and she is shunned by society.

Writers of Hell or High Water, La La Land, Arrival and Deadpool are among the nominees for this year’s Writers Guild Awards.
Writers of Hell or High Water (pictured), La La Land, Arrival and Deadpool are among the nominees for this year’s Writers Guild Awards, set to be presented at ceremonies hosted by the West and East branches of the Writers Guild of America (WGA) on Feb 19.
Also nominated in the WGA’s original screenplay category are the writers of Loving, Manchester By The Sea and Moonlight. Fences, Hidden Figures and Nocturnal Animals produced the other nominations in the adapted screenplay category.
Documentary nominations went to Author: The Jt Leroy Story, Command And Control and Zero Days, while dramatic TV series getting nods were The Americans, Better Call Saul, Game Of Thrones, Stranger Things and Westworld.

The Writers Guild of America has just announced the nominations for their annual awards for Best Screenplays (by writers who are guild signatories). That’s right, before you get nervous thinking that your favorite may have been left off the list, you must remember that the WGA is the group that is not all-inclusive and leaves out several of the top contenders each year due to them not being part of the guild or not following their very specific rules. For this reason, you won’t see Inside Out, The Hateful Eight, and Ex Machina in the Original Screenplay category or Room, Brooklyn, or Anomalisa in the Adapted screenplay category.

The Writers Guild of America announced some of its nominees for its 2015 awards on Thursday, including television, new media, and radio, and among the TV nominees are series both new and old, and all beloved.
In the comedy series category, freshman Netflix show "Unbreakable Kimmy Schmidt" scored a nomination for best series, as well as an overall best new series nod. "The Last Man on Earth" also landed in that latter category, and was singled out for its pilot episode writing, too.
On the drama side of the equation, lauded "Breaking Bad" spinoff "Better Call Saul" also got best series and best new series nominations, in addition to a an episode writing nod. Newly-minted Emmy winner "Game of Thrones" also scored a best drama citation, as well as an episodic writing nomination.
